The foundation of any profitable betting strategy is strict and disciplined financial management.


Without a solid financial plan, even the luckiest winning streak will eventually turn into a devastating loss.

How to Determine Your Starting Funds

Your bankroll should be an amount of money you are completely comfortable losing forever.


If your total budget is $1,000, you should never bring the entire amount to a single table.

Determine your bet sizing based on your total bankroll; never bet more than 2% on a single handIf you hit a predetermined winning goal, take your profits and leave the tableKeep your gambling funds in a completely separate bank account from your regular finances
Understanding Bet Sizing and Variance

Your standard bet should be small enough to withstand the natural mathematical swings of the game.


For table games like blackjack, professional players recommend betting no more than 1% to 2% of your total bankroll.
